WebThe typical Elizabethan stage was a platform, as large as 40 feet square (more than 12 metres on each side), sticking out into the middle of the yard so that the spectators nearly surrounded it. Richard … WebIn the year that Henry VIII came to the throne (1509), the number of works licensed to be published was 38. In the year of Elizabeth’s accession (1558), it was 77; in the year of her death (1603), it was 328. In the year of Charles I’s …

WebMay 23, 2015 · From popular ballads to ringing psalms, Elizabethan music was creative, pleasant and stirring. But perhaps the most influential contribution of this era is the precursor of intricate musical arrangement, the consort.
